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ia – Another Raya campaign is gracing our screens. The love and care for family are one of the biggest reminders of the Hari Raya celebrations and Zurich Malaysia, the insurance provider, has unveiled a short film on a rather mellow touch circling the theme and one that truly tugs at the heartstrings.
Done in collaboration with Mediabrands Content Studio (MBCS), the brand’s heart-warming film titled ‘Kepulangan’, or which means ‘The Return’, centres around Zurich’s Raya theme of embracing togetherness. The film tells the story of Zyra and her in-laws as they navigate the emotions surrounding the passing of her husband, the son in the family. Through these emotional upheavals, she discovers upon returning to his family home that, in the end, they will always belong together as a family and that the bond of a family is forever.
